    Tim Army Anaheim Ducks endorses KIHA youth hockey developmental program

    “Doug Jones, introduced our oldest son, Derek, to inline hockey when I was an assistant coach with the Mighty Ducks of Anaheim in the mid-1990's. 

    It was Derek's first foray into organized team sports. He couldn't have had a better coach than Doug for that big step. Doug is very knowledgeable and also a very good teacher. Derek was only four years old at the time, but Doug was able to connect with Derek at such a young age on Derek's level. Most importantly, he was a passionate and compassionate coach. It was a wonderful experience. Derek improved both his skill set as well as his understanding of the game. But more importantly, Doug taught Derek about the competitive side of the game in an understated way as that competitiveness is so critical as young athletes climb the ladder in sports. 

    Derek went on to play Division 1 college ice hockey at Providence College and professional hockey in both the ECHL, AHL, as well as one NHL exhibition game with the Nashville Predators. Today Derek is the head coach of the Wheeling Nailers, the Pittsburgh Penguins affiliate in the ECHL. 

    As parents, we don't believe Derek would have accomplished all that he has without Doug's influence all those years ago in the Anaheim Bullfrogs youth inline program. We recommend Doug as a coach unequivocally. To this day, we are grateful for all that Doug did for Derek when he was just a little boy being introduced to organized sports for the very first time.

    Tim Army 
    Assistant coach 
    Anaheim Ducks NHL 
    7/16/2024

    KIHA MISSION STATEMENT

    THE MISSION OF KIHA IS TO PROVIDE PLAYERS OF ALL AGES AND SKILL LEVELS BOTH MALE AND FEMALE A VERY SAFE AND FUN ENVIRONMENT TO LEARN AND PLAY INLINE HOCKEY.  

    Committment to KIHA - Our youth program asks that any youth participant that does sign up please make their Saturday games for the benefit of our program and it's fellow members.

    Everyone Plays - Our goal is for Kids to play Inline hockey , so we mandate that every child on every team must play at least half of every game.

    Balanced Teams - Each year we form teams as evenly as possible, because it is fair and more fun when teams of equal ability play.

    Positive Coaching - All of our coaches are AAU background screened and encouragement of player effort provides for greater enjoyment by the players and ultimately leads to better skilled and better motivated players.

    Good Sportsmanship - We strive to create a safe, fair, fun and positive environment based on mutual respect, rather than a win at all costs attitude, and our program is designed to instill good sportsmanship in every facet of KIHA.

    Player Development - We believe that all players should be able to develop their inline hockey skills and knowledge to the best of their abilities, both individually and as members of a team, in order to maximize their enjoyment of the game.
